Anderson woke up first, he reached around and his mommy was gone. He called out softly, "Mommy."

No one answered him.

Puzzled, he climbed out of bed, put on his slippers, and walked to the living room. Still, he could not find his mommy, but Uncle Luther was still sleeping on the couch.

It was already bright and warm sunlight was coming in through the glass.

Anderson searched around and didn't see his mommy. He went to the couch and shook Luther, "Uncle Luther, Uncle Luther, wake up." Luther was awakened by the sound. He sat up and picked Anderson up and cradled him in his arms.

"What's wrong, Anderson?" he asked.

The sleep was so comfortable and so reassuring that he felt better and his palms were no longer hot.

Holding the soft little ball in his arms, he felt so happy.

"Uncle Luther, Mommy's gone." Anderson reached out and touched Luther's forehead, "You're better, no more fever.”

"Hmm. Mommy's gone?" Luther froze and looked around.

Sure enough, she was not at home, and even her slippers were left at the door.

He frowned. She left the child at home and went out? She was just too irresponsible as a mother. No matter how mature Anderson was, he was, after all, less than four years old.

However, on second thought...

Was it because he was home? That's why she was comfortable going out? If so, it was a sign of trust in him.

When he thought of this, he was in a good mood.

He immediately got up from the sofa and picked Anderson up, "Anderson, good boy, Mommy must have gone out to buy you a delicious breakfast. Let's brush our teeth and wash our faces and wait for your mommy together, okay?"

Anderson nodded.
